Mattress panels including flame retardant fibers
Mattress assemblies including fiber panels generally include bicomponent fibers including optically active particles within a core thereof. The bicomponent fibers can be treated with a fire retardant or untreated and blended with fire retardant fibers. The bicomponent fibers are configured to transform radiant body heat of an end user.
SYSTEM AND METHOD OF SMART SEATING MANAGEMENT
A seating management system having a plurality of chairs, each chair having a code scanner, an object detection sensor, a motor, and a communication device in operative communication with a central management server. The central management server is configured to pre-assign a reservation code for each of the chairs, assign each of the invited guests to a chair, cause an invitation to be sent to each of said invited guests, and analyze the invited guest responses. The server is then configured to activate the plurality of chairs, send the corresponding reservation code to each guest whose response accepted the invitation, and cause the motor of the respective activated chair to move said chair when the central management server receives a reservation code corresponding to said chair.
Flame retardant mattress core cap and method of making same
A fabric made by the method of providing a non-woven batt having flame retardant fibers, stitch bonding the non-woven batt with an elastic yarn, and heat setting the stitch bonded, non-woven batt. The stitch bonded non-woven batt is exposed to a temperature in a range of 160° C. to 200° C. for a period in a range of 30 seconds to 120 seconds. In an embodiment, the fabric is adapted for use as a mattress core cover.
Stretchable flame barrier panels
A stretchable flame barrier panel including an interior stretch zone having elastomeric yarns extending across a fibrous base layer of textile fibers and optionally substantially stable lateral selvage zones outboard of the interior stretch zone. In a finished state, the interior stretch zone has substantial stretch and recovery in both the machine direction and the cross-machine direction.
Vehicle seating assembly
A vehicle seating assembly includes a seat base that has a first heating element. A seat back has a second heating element. A sensor is coupled to the seat base and is configured to obtain a weight data. A user-interface assembly is operably coupled to the first and second heating elements. A controller is in communication with the sensor to receive the weight data. The controller is configured to control the first and second heating elements in response to the weight data.
Bed cooling assembly
A bed cooling assembly includes a blower unit that is positionable adjacent to a bed for sleeping. A pair of hoses is each of the hoses is fluidly coupled to the blower unit to direct the air blown by the blower unit. A pair of restraints is each removably attachable to a respective one of the hoses to mount the respective hose to the sleeping bed. A pair of exhaust vents is each fluidly coupled to a respective one of the hoses to receive the air from the blower unit. Each of the exhaust vents is positionable between the sleeping bed and a blanket on the sleeping bed to direct the air onto a user sleeping on the sleeping bed thereby cooling the user.
Bed bug prevention band
A preventive device involves an elastic band capable of being secured about the base of a mattress or box spring. The elastic band is impregnated or coated with a composition that repels bed bugs. The elastic band also protects bedding from the infestation of bedbugs, which is much easier than eradication.
Protective patient procedure chair/table toe protective cover with improved hygienic and adaptable design for medical treatment furnishings
A protective cover improves the hygiene of patient procedure chair/table, such as a toe cover. There is a need to for an improvement on the ability to effectively disinfect all components of a universally adaptable protective cover applied to the toe area of healthcare furnishing/patient procedure chair. The embodiments of the present protective cover is universally adaptable to various shapes and sizes found in patient procedure chairs. Textiles selected for use include vinyl, medical grade upholstery vinyl, or other textiles that may be used in healthcare settings so that all components can be disinfected with intermediate grade disinfectants. The design also allows for decoratively enhancing the patient environment. Dental patient chair will be used to demonstrate images. The design can be adapted to various patient chairs and tables.

THERAPEUTIC ORTHOPEDIC MATTRESS FOR PETS AND ASSOCIATED METHODS
A therapeutic orthopedic mattress for pets includes a top cover, a first layer covered by the top cover, and a second layer underlying the first layer. The mattress also includes an antennae comprising an elongated wire having a first end positioned proximate a first end of the first layer and a second end longitudinally spaced apart from the first end proximate a second opposing end of the first layer. The antennae is spread out between the first layer and the top cover. In addition, the method includes a microprocessor coupled to the first end of the antennae and is configured to distribute a plurality of sequences of intermittent electrical signals along the antennae to the second end. The mattress also includes a plurality of magnetic discs and far infrared radiation discs dispersed over a top surface of the first layer.
